Scalability and Flexibility
Azure Cloud VMs offer unparalleled scalability and flexibility. You can create and manage VMs with ease, selecting from a wide range of preconfigured images or customizing your own. Azure also supports various operating systems, including Windows Server, Linux, and SQL Server.
Permissions Management with Azure RBAC
Azure Role-Based Access Control (RBAC) simplifies permissions management for Azure Cloud VMs. With RBAC, you can assign specific roles to users, groups, or services at various scopes. This approach ensures that only the right people have access to the right resources, minimizing the risk of unauthorized access and human error.
Azure Backup for Robust Data Protection
Azure Backup is a cloud-based backup solution that simplifies data protection and recovery for Azure Cloud VMs. You can create backup policies, configure retention settings, and restore data directly from the Azure portal. Azure Backup also supports backup for VMs deployed in Azure Virtual Machines, Azure Dedicated Hosts, and Azure Stack Hub.

Comparisons and Best Practices
When comparing Azure Cloud VMs to other cloud platforms, consider the following:
Cost: Azure Cloud VMs offer competitive pricing, with various cost and billing options, such as pay-as-you-go, reserved instances, and spot instances
Integration: Azure Cloud VMs integrate seamlessly with other Azure services, including Azure Monitor, Azure Logic Apps, and Azure Functions, providing a cohesive and efficient platform for your workloads
Security: Azure Cloud VMs come with built-in security features, such as Azure Security Center, Azure Advisor, and Azure Policy, ensuring that your VMs stay secure and compliant
